Short Description
Do you claim to place your faith fully in God yet still hold tightly to the reins of your life? Do you declare His perfect timing and provision yet find yourself drowning in a sea of worry? Could it be that you are a Christian Atheist?

Pastor and author Craig Groeschel knows this topic all too well. After being raised in a Christian home and logging over a decade of successful ministry, he had to make a painful admission: although he believed in God, he was leading his church and his family as if God didn’t even exist.

Join Craig on an intimate journey toward a more authentic and God-honoring life. In an age of spiritual relativism and lackluster faith, it is more important than ever to ask ourselves an honest and painful question: Am I putting my whole faith in God but still living as if everything is up to me?
